Step-by-step explanation:

The domain is the set of all allowed x values of a function. These are the inputs.

The furthest to the left we can go is x = -1. A closed endpoint is here meaning we include this as part of the domain. Unfortunately the other endpoint 3 is not included due to the open hole.

So x is between -1 and 3, including -1 but excluding 3

We can write that as the compound inequality
-1 \le \text{x} < 3 which then directly translates into the interval notation [ -1, 3 )

The square bracket includes the endpoint -1; in contrast, the curved parenthesis excludes 3

----------------------------------------

The range deals with the output y values. It's the set of all possible outputs.

The lowest we can go is y = -5 but we can't actually reach it because of the open hole.

The highest we can go is y = 4 and we can reach this value.

Hence the range as a compound inequality is
-5 < \text{y} \le 4 and that leads to the interval notation ( -5, 4 ]

Once again, take note of the use of square brackets vs curved parenthesis. This time we're excluding the lower endpoint but including the higher endpoint.
